  1. East Brookfield is a relatively small community located on Route 9, approximately 15 miles west of Worcester and 35 miles east of Springfield. The center of town is built on picturesque Lake Lashaway.

  2. East Brookfield is a town in Worcester County, Massachusetts, United States. The population was 2,224 at the 2020 United States Census. [1] The census-designated place of East Brookfield (CDP) is located in the town.

  3. In 1673 a significant portion of the plantation became the town of Brookfield, which then included the villages of West Brookfield, North Brookfield, East Brookfield and Podunk. The early 1700s were a period of industrial expansion for our eastern township.

  7. The Town of East Brookfield Massachusetts also known as “the baby town of the Commonwealth” was founded in 1920 and is located in Worcester County. East Brookfield is the birthplace of Connie Mack who was at first a star catcher but was famed more as manager of the Philadelphia Athletics since 1901.
